Etymology[edit]

Borrowed from Spanish Urzúa, itself of Basque origin.

Proper noun[edit]

Urzua (plural Urzuas)

  1. A surname.

Statistics[edit]

  • According to the 2010 United States Census, Urzua is the 16385th most common surname in the United States, belonging to 1757 individuals. Urzua is most common among Hispanic/Latino (95.39%) individuals.
